    We are looking for a Product Line Technical Director (PLTD) for our FAST Labs Microelectronics Product Line
    The Microelectronics team charter spans the full lifecycle from science and technology to production
    We focus on wafer level and chip/module level products involving RF, mixed signal, and digital domains
    The Microelectronics PLTD will focus on technical strategies, new business growth, product leverage, talent development, and continuous improvement
    The PLTD acts as a technical advisor/partner to the Microelectronics Product Line Director and the FAST Labs Chief Technologist
    The PLTD helps define technical strategies for competitive bids, customer engagement, and business models
    The PLTD reports to the FAST Labs Chief Engineer (aka Business Area Engineering Director), and provides technical leadership for the assigned product line during all lifecycle phases (conception, design, development, production, and support)
    The successful applicant will bring strong microelectronics design, production and test background; positive experience in contracted research & development (CRAD) leadership (shaping, capturing and executing CRAD); as well as product design and development applicable to hardware, software and/or algorithmic-based application solutions
